Summary

Texas A&M held its first preseason practice in preparation for the 2026 season, which opens against Missouri State in four weeks. The team's focus is on the availability of senior linebacker Daymion Sanford, who is recovering from a serious lower-body injury he sustained during the Maroon & White Game. Coach Mike Elko indicated that Sanford is on track to participate in fall camp, though he will likely be on a snap count to manage his reintegration. Sanford's experience is critical for the Aggies' defensive strategy, and further updates on his status are anticipated as camp progresses.
